摘要: 在java里,一个函数想要传入不同的数据类型的参数,就要写多个函数,每个函数名一样,参数不一样,这一点和python不同,python一个函数就可以支持多种的数据类型。 方法重载(overload) 概念:一个类中的一组方法,相同的方法名字,不同的参数列表,这样的一组方法构成了方法重载 参数列表的不 阅读全文
posted @ 2020-05-21 20:14 我是一言 阅读(142) 评论(0) 推荐(0) 编辑
摘要: 类名字 Test TestOne TestOneTwo 属性/方法 驼峰 test testOne testOneTwo 构造方法 与类名一致,类中唯一的大写字母开头的方法 静态常量 全部字母大写,通过下划线做具体说明 BOOKSTORE_ADMIN 包名 全部字母小写,java关键字都是小写,注意 阅读全文
posted @ 2020-05-21 20:13 我是一言 阅读(103) 评论(0) 推荐(0) 编辑
摘要: 形参和实参 形参可以理解为是方法执行时的临时变量空间 x 形参可以理解为是方法执行时的临时变量空间 a 方法调用时会将实参的内容传递给形参 如果内容是基本类型,传递的是值,形参改变,实参不变 如果内容是引用类型,传递的是引用,形参改变,实参跟着改变 方法中的参数传递及返回值内存原理(基础类型) pu 阅读全文
posted @ 2020-05-21 20:12 我是一言 阅读(247) 评论(0) 推荐(0) 编辑
摘要: **类中的方法 > 做一件事情 描述一个方法 权限修饰符 [特征修饰符] 返回值类型 方法名字 (参数列表) [抛出异常] [{ 方法体 }] 必须有的结构 权限修饰符 返回值类型 方法名字 () { } 1. 无参数无返回值 2. 无参数有返回值 3. 有参数无返回值 4. 有参数有返回值 Per 阅读全文
posted @ 2020-05-21 20:09 我是一言 阅读(121) 评论(0) 推荐(0) 编辑
摘要: 面向过程 大象装冰箱,总共分几步 1.开门,2.大象装里面,3.关门 以过程为本--复用性差--增加了很多冗余 面向对象 考虑大象装冰箱有几个实体参与 人,冰箱,大象 分析每一个类格体都有什么特点,做了哪些事 大象 特点 大 ,体重很重 冰箱 特点 有门,有体积 人 特点 能做事情 做哪些?开冰箱门 阅读全文
posted @ 2020-05-21 00:23 我是一言 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 1. 定义/声明 里面存储的类型[] 数组名字; int[][] array; 2. 初始化 静态 有长度 有元素 int[][] array = {{1,2},{3,4,5,6},{7,8,9}}; 动态 只有长度 没有元素(默认) int[][] array =new int[3][2]; // 阅读全文
posted @ 2020-05-21 00:20 我是一言 阅读(222) 评论(0) 推荐(0) 编辑